๐ KEY RESPONSIBILITIES
โ
Quality Assurance System Oversight
- Review, revise, and authorise departmental SOPs
- Manage full QA function including:
- Document control, Site Master File, Quality Manual & Policy
- Validation Master Plan implementation
- Internal & external audits and deviation tracking
- Root Cause Analysis (RCA), CAPAs & Change Control
- Product Quality Reviews and Quality Management Review meetings
- Supplier approvals and quality agreements
- Non-conformances, Out-of-Specification (OOS) investigations, and ADR reporting
- Implementing and monitoring Stability Master Plan and pest control programme
๐ Product Complaints & Recalls
- Investigate and resolve product quality complaints
- Ensure full batch traceability for effective recall procedures
๐ฆ Returned / Rejected Goods
- Proper handling of returned or rejected goods
- Decision-making on re-testing, re-packing, or destruction
๐งช GMP/GWP/GHP Compliance
- Conduct third-party audits
- Ensure compliance across storage, transport, packaging, and destruction of medicines
- GMP training and internal audits
- Batch quarantine, sampling, release, and documentation
๐ Training & Team Support
- Ensure continuous GxP and SOP training for all departments
- Support a culture of teamwork, accountability, and compliance
